At least for now, the iPhone and the Pixel are going in different directions
Today’s Apple event also reveals that while the Pixel and iPhone may be friends in Google’s popular stop-action videos, they are going in different directions for now. The iPhone Air is an example of the future of the iPhone with innovations in design and battery longevity. That’s not to say that Google isn’t interested in the design of its Pixel line. But Google has something more important in mind for the Pixel line than how it looks.


This is something that I’ve thought about many times before. With its focus on AI, Google seems to want the Pixel to be a tool that consumers can use to make their lives easier. On the other hand, the half-baked way that Apple Intelligence was delivered to iPhone users was frustrating. And while Google is well along in transitioning from Google Assistant to Gemini on Pixel phones, Siri still has trouble answering some queries and will often ask if you mind having the question turned over to ChatGPT for a response.
